What's Happening?
India is making strides to reduce its dependency on foreign strawberry varieties by investing in innovative agricultural techniques. Ketan Yashwant Sodha, CEO of Berry Fresh Agrotech, has been experimenting with hydroponics to combat the adverse effects
of unpredictable weather on traditional open-field farming. Despite initial setbacks, Sodha's efforts have led to successful trials of various strawberry varieties, including rare Japanese and Dutch types. The use of hydroponics allows for precise control over water and nutrient supply, resulting in higher quality fruit. Meanwhile, Krishan Bhilare, part of a Farmer Producer Organisation, is utilizing AI and vertical farming to enhance productivity. These advancements aim to increase yield and reduce losses, offering a sustainable solution for India's strawberry farmers.
Why It's Important?
The shift towards domestic strawberry cultivation using advanced techniques like hydroponics and AI-driven farming is significant for India's agricultural sector. It addresses the challenges posed by climate change and unpredictable weather patterns, which have historically led to crop failures. By reducing reliance on imported varieties, India can enhance its agricultural self-sufficiency and potentially increase exports. This move also supports local farmers by providing them with tools to improve yield and quality, thereby boosting their income. The adoption of technology in agriculture could serve as a model for other crops, promoting innovation and sustainability across the sector.
